Overview

#B954BC is a cool, light color. In RGB it is 185, 84, 188, in HSL 298.3°, 43.7%, 53.3%, and in CMYK 1.6%, 55.3%, 0.0%, 26.3%. The nearest named color is orchid 3.

Color Psychology

Magenta is a stimulating, attention-commanding color that bridges passion and imagination. It represents transformation, artistic vision, and unconventional thinking. Magenta disrupts expectations and is associated with innovation and bold self-expression.

Design Usage

Medium magentas are powerful for brands that want to project creativity and boldness. They create eye-catching gradients when blended with purple or orange tones. Use sparingly as accent colors for maximum impact in otherwise restrained designs.
